Hunting has a rich history and many modern uses. For some, it is a thrilling sport; for others, it is a chance to challenge nature; and then for those like me, it is a way to provide food and other necessities.
Wild game meat is free from hormones and harmful chemicals, is organic, and is really good for you. If you can catch it yourself, then you will literally know where your meat comes from. You can prepare the meat yourself too. My book will teach you how.
